Joel Friedman | Center on Budget and Policy Priorities

Image Joel Friedman is Vice President for Federal Fiscal Policy at the Center on Budget and Policy Priorities (CBPP), where he specializes in U.S. federal budget and tax issues, and a Senior Fellow at the International Budget Partnership (IBP), where he focuses on budget transparency and accountability in countries around the world. Prior to his work at CBPP and IBP, he worked on the Democratic staff of both the Senate and House Budget Committees (as deputy staff director and director of budget analysis, respectively), and as a financial economist at the U.S. Office of Management and Budget. In addition, from 1996 to 2000, he worked in the South African Ministry of Finance as the U.S. Treasury s Resident Advisor, helping to develop and implement budget reforms with a particular focus on intergovernmental fiscal relations. He holds an M.P.A. from Princeton University’s Woodrow Wilson School of Public and International Affairs and a B.A. from Pomona College.

Biden could prove the Solyndra scandal wasn t a failure — Quartz

February 4, 2021 In the summer of 2010, Nina Eichacker was an intern at the US Department of Energy, analyzing the successes and failures of energy projects that received DOE funding. She didn’t realize that a high-profile failure was brewing right under her nose, and would soon put the department’s loan program one of the government’s biggest pots of money for clean energy innovation on ice. Ten years later, Eichacker is among the economists urging the Biden administration to revitalize the program, which is currently sitting on $44 billion in unused, Congressionally-authorized clean energy loans and loan guarantees that quietly gathered dust under Donald Trump. The question is whether the administration is willing to stomach the toxic politics that festered around the program because of one misplaced loan: Solyndra.

Yang leads into outsider status in run for NYC mayor while critics question experience

Yang, a former Democratic presidential candidate who outlasted governors and senators in the nominating race despite sporting a thin political resume, is again running in a crowded primary field packed with candidates with beefier governing or business experience. And he’s again dogged by concerns that he has too little know-how to be running for office in such a time of crisis. In this race, however, Yang is an early front-runner, a distinction that provides a broader profile but also forces him to address questions about his experience more forcefully than he ever had to in his long-shot presidential bid.
